Problem
Current demand control systems for power-consuming apparatuses do not effectively address the decrease in power-source power factor, leading to increased electricity charges and potential penalties, as they fail to optimize the power-factor control efficiently.
Innovation Solution
A power-source power factor control system that dynamically adjusts the operation state of load apparatuses based on real-time power-source power factor measurements, using a variable target value to optimize the power factor while minimizing changes in operation capability, thereby improving and stabilizing the power factor.

Engineering Contradiction Analysis
1Loss of energy
If demand control is performed based on amount of power only, then power consumption is reduced, but power-source power factor deteriorates
Solution Approach 1:
The system changes the control parameter from amount of power only to a composite parameter that includes both amount of power and power-source power factor. The demand control signal is generated based on both parameters, allowing simultaneous optimization of power consumption and power factor by adjusting load operation states according to the combined demand index.
2Reliability
If load apparatus operation capability is actively changed to optimize power factor, then power-source power factor is improved, but operation capability of load apparatus deteriorates
Solution Approach 1:
The system dynamically adjusts the target value of power-source power factor based on the current operational state of load apparatuses. Instead of fixed power factor targets, the system modifies targets in real-time to balance power factor improvement with minimal impact on load operation capability, using dynamic weighting between power factor and operation capability.
Solution Approach 2:
The system applies partial action by selectively adjusting only certain load apparatuses or certain operational parameters of loads rather than uniformly reducing all load capabilities. This allows power factor optimization through targeted adjustments while maintaining overall operation capability.
3Ease of operation
If fixed target value of power-source power factor is used, then control simplicity is maintained, but adaptability to varying power factor conditions deteriorates
Solution Approach 1:
The system transitions from static fixed target values to dynamic target values that automatically adapt to varying power factor conditions. The target value is calculated based on current power factor measurements and load characteristics, providing both simplicity through automated calculation and adaptability to changing conditions.
Solution Approach 2:
The system implements feedback mechanisms where actual power factor measurements are continuously monitored and used to adjust the target value. This closed-loop control provides adaptability to varying conditions while maintaining ease of operation through automated feedback-based target adjustment.

A load apparatus (1, 2) is connected to an AC power source (3) and is supplied with power from the AC power source (3). An operation state control unit (1c, 2c) controls, based on a target value about a power-source quality including either a power-source power factor of the AC power source (3) or a power-source harmonic of the AC power source (3) and on a present power-source quality, an operation state of the load apparatus (1,2).
